Do optometrists near Woodlawn, VA accept my vision or medical insurance?
Coverage varies. Many optometry practices in the region accept major medical insurance (like Anthem Blue Cross Blue Shield, which is common in Virginia) and vision plans (such as VSP or EyeMed). It's crucial to call the specific office beforehand, as some smaller, independent practices in rural areas like Woodlawn may have more limited network participation. Be sure to ask if they bill Medicare and handle Medicaid for eligible patients, as this is an important service for many in the community.
What should I consider when choosing between optometrists in a rural area like Woodlawn?
Given Woodlawn's rural setting, key factors include travel distance and office hours that accommodate your schedule. Consider if the optometrist has a well-equipped on-site optical lab for quicker glasses repairs and adjustments, which saves trips to larger towns. Check their availability for urgent care (like eye infections or foreign object removal) to avoid long drives to an ER. Also, look for a practitioner with experience managing conditions prevalent in the area, such as allergies or diabetes-related eye issues. Personal rapport is especially valued in close-knit communities.
How far in advance do I typically need to book an eye exam with a Woodlawn-area optometrist?
Wait times can vary. For a routine comprehensive exam with a popular local optometrist, you might need to schedule 2 to 6 weeks in advance, especially for evening or Saturday appointments, which are in high demand. New patient appointments may have longer lead times. For more urgent but non-emergency concerns, many offices in Carroll County reserve slots for same-day or next-day visits for established patients. It's best to call early, particularly before the end of the year if you need to use remaining insurance benefits.
